#815c8c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#815c8c is composed of 50.6% red, 36.1%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.9% cyan, 34.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 286.3 degrees, a saturation of 20.7% and a lightness of 45.5%. #815c8c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b8ff with #030019.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

#815c8c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#815c8c has RGB values of R:129, G:92,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.34,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 8477836.

Shades and Tints of #815c8c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09060a is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#815c8c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#776e7a is the less saturated color, while #b103e5 is the most saturated one.
